mirror of
https://gerrit.wikimedia.org/r/mediawiki/extensions/VisualEditor
synced 2024-09-24 10:48:42 +00:00
Remove some hardcoded CAPTCHA support code
While we pretend that the ConfirmEdit CAPTCHA support is added by ve.init.mw.CaptchaSaveErrorHandler in the ConfirmEdit extension, we still have a bunch of code here required for it to work. This commit removes some of it, no longer needed after I6605017fd31a4f96c529dd0beb69e9f4433cebc1. Depends-On: I6605017fd31a4f96c529dd0beb69e9f4433cebc1 Change-Id: I41e032fd754927b7ea6cfb767eb9f21b522ccacd
This commit is contained in:
parent
108131f4e1
commit
1846b72998
|
@ -1623,7 +1623,6 @@
|
|||
"mediawiki.widgets",
|
||||
"ext.visualEditor.switching",
|
||||
"ext.visualEditor.welcome",
|
||||
"ext.visualEditor.mwextensionmessages",
|
||||
"oojs-ui.styles.icons-editing-advanced"
|
||||
],
|
||||
"messages": [
|
||||
|
|
|
@ -1042,28 +1042,6 @@ class VisualEditorHooks {
|
|||
'targets' => [ 'desktop', 'mobile' ],
|
||||
] ] );
|
||||
}
|
||||
|
||||
$extensionMessages = [];
|
||||
$extensionRegistry = ExtensionRegistry::getInstance();
|
||||
if ( $extensionRegistry->isLoaded( 'ConfirmEdit' ) ) {
|
||||
$extensionMessages[] = 'captcha-edit';
|
||||
$extensionMessages[] = 'captcha-label';
|
||||
|
||||
if ( $extensionRegistry->isLoaded( 'QuestyCaptcha' ) ) {
|
||||
$extensionMessages[] = 'questycaptcha-edit';
|
||||
}
|
||||
|
||||
if ( $extensionRegistry->isLoaded( 'FancyCaptcha' ) ) {
|
||||
$extensionMessages[] = 'fancycaptcha-edit';
|
||||
$extensionMessages[] = 'fancycaptcha-reload-text';
|
||||
}
|
||||
}
|
||||
$resourceLoader->register( [
|
||||
'ext.visualEditor.mwextensionmessages' => $veResourceTemplate + [
|
||||
'messages' => $extensionMessages,
|
||||
'targets' => [ 'desktop', 'mobile' ],
|
||||
]
|
||||
] );
|
||||
}
|
||||
|
||||
/**
|
||||
|
|
|
@ -100,10 +100,6 @@
|
|||
font-style: italic;
|
||||
}
|
||||
|
||||
.ve-ui-saveDialog-captchaInput {
|
||||
margin-top: 0.5em;
|
||||
}
|
||||
|
||||
.ve-ui-mwSaveDialog-visualDiffFeedback {
|
||||
float: right;
|
||||
}
|
||||
|
|
Loading…
Reference in a new issue